The ADP5301ACBZ-1-R7 is a voltage regulator belonging to the category of power management integrated circuits (PMICs). This device is designed to provide efficient and reliable power management solutions for various electronic applications. The ADP5301ACBZ-1-R7 features the following pin configuration: 1. VIN: Input Voltage 2. SW: Switching Node 3. GND: Ground 4. FB: Feedback 5. EN: Enable 6. PG: Power Good 7. VOUT: Output Voltage 8. AGND: Analog Ground
The ADP5301ACBZ-1-R7 operates as a step-down (buck) voltage regulator, converting a higher input voltage to a lower output voltage with high efficiency. The internal control loop maintains the output voltage within specified tolerances, providing a stable power supply for connected loads.
The ADP5301ACBZ-1-R7 is suitable for a wide range of portable and battery-powered applications, including: - Mobile devices - Wearable electronics - Portable medical devices - IoT (Internet of Things) devices - Handheld instruments
